Output a32efb32b187a32ea3e5d68692ad09ebfc3053b1387bcb8d2fbb74a64e7bb5de:0

value
123584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c58343c4c0a80b464bffa105efad47eb3e9e317a OP_EQUAL
address
3KhNHmScQ5PMQRhLVNHggz8T4dabADk2rb
transaction
a32efb32b187a32ea3e5d68692ad09ebfc3053b1387bcb8d2fbb74a64e7bb5de
confirmations
313341
spent
true